Iscovich Foundation is located in Santa Barbara, CA. The organization was established in 2005. According to its NTEE Classification (T20) the organization is classified as: Private Grantmaking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Iscovich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Iscovich Foundation generated $4.5k in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 8 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(15.0%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$14.8k during the year ending 12/2022. As we would expect to see with falling revenues, expenses have declined by (8.2%) per year over the past 8 years. Since 2015, Iscovich Foundation has awarded 77 individual grants totaling $158,050. If you would like to learn more about the grant giving history of this organization, scroll down to the grant profile section of this page.

Over the last fiscal year, Iscovich Foundation has awarded $11,900 in support to 7 organizations.
Grant Recipient | Amount |
---|---|
SOLVANG THEATERFEST PURPOSE: SUPPORT A UNIQUE LIVE PERFORMING ART VENUE THAT PROMOTES THE HIGHEST QUALITY EXPERIENCE FOR ARTISTS AND AUDIENCE MEMBERS IN A SPACE THAT IS SAFE AND ACCESSIBLE TO ALL. | $2,500 |
SANTA BARBARA COTTAGE HOSPITAL FOUNDATION PURPOSE: DEDICATED TO SUPPORTING THE SANTA BARBARA COTTAGE HOSPITAL AND THEIR MISSION TO PROVIDE SUPERIOR HEALTH CARE AND IMPROVE THE HEALTH OF THE REGION - WITH EXCELLENCE, INTEGRITY, AND COMPASSION. | $2,000 |
LOMPOC HOSPITAL FOUNDATION PURPOSE: DEDICATED TO SUPPORTING THE LOMPOC VALLEY MEDICAL CENTER AND THEIR MISSION TO PROVIDE AN ADVANCED GE HEALTHCARE MRI TO IMPROVE THE HEALTH OF THE REGION. | $500 |
SYV AIRPORT AUTHORITY PURPOSE: SUPPORT THE NEXT GENERATION OF PILOTS BY PROVIDING STUDY MATERIALS, FLIGHT INSTRUCTOR CHARGES, FUEL, AIRCRAFT RENTALS, AND TRAINING TO RECEIVE A PRIVATE PILOT'S CERTIFICATE. | $500 |
HUMAN RIGHTS WATCH PURPOSE: SUPPORT REFUGEES AND BRING AWARENESS TO THE INJUSTICE OF HUMAN RIGHTS ABUSES ACROSS THE WORLD. | $1,400 |
UNITE TO LIGHT PURPOSE: SUPPORT PROVIDING LOW-COST SOLAR LIGHT AND POWER TO THOSE WITHOUT ELECTRICITY ACROSS THE GLOBE. | $2,000 |
